The Seattle Times editorial board recommends: Julie Wise for King County Elections Director

In terms of overseeing elections, King County voters deserve a pacesetter with expertise and who is devoted to equity and open to innovation. Julie Smart brings that and extra to the election workplace and ought to be reelected to a 3rd time period in November.

Because the 2020 elections, Smart has fought off voter intimidation efforts, answered 1000’s of calls and emails about election fraud, and labored to verify voters can train their proper with confidence within the election course of.

To extend voter participation, Smart advocates educating highschool college students in regards to the significance of voting and for preregistration for 16- and 17-year-olds. She stated her workplace has employed a marketing consultant to assist get teenagers engaged in voter schooling early. Her work has paid off with 91% of voting-eligible King County residents registered to vote.

Smart has labored for King County Elections for 23 years, beginning as a clerk working the cellphone financial institution. Since she was first elected in 2015, the county has enormously expanded poll drop field places from 10 to greater than 75.

Smart supported Senate Invoice 5208, which turned regulation this spring. The regulation permits for on-line voter registration utilizing the final 4 digits of an individual’s Social Safety quantity.

As well as, Seattle will want Smart’s experience because it prepares to modify to ranked-choice voting by fall 2027.

In terms of poll integrity, Washington’s vote-by-mail system is among the many nation’s most secure. But that didn’t cease some from stoking concern amongst residents that shadiness was going down at elections workplaces right here and throughout the state. With former President Donald Trump more likely to reactivate groups of conspiracy theorists for the 2024 election, King County wants an election director who can intelligently defend our voting system. Smart is that particular person.

Nevertheless, we do discover troubling a current incident during which the Republican and Democratic events weren’t notified or invited to witness a Logic and Accuracy Take a look at of a brand new backup server. Smart defends this by claiming state regulation doesn’t require such witnesses, however acknowledges that her workplace will notify each events sooner or later. Moreover, a safety digital camera that usually would have recorded the check was inoperable. “This was a collection of unlucky occasions however we now have put issues in place to verify it doesn’t occur once more,” Smart advised the editorial board.

Smart’s opponent, Doug Basler, didn’t make himself accessible to The Seattle Instances editorial board for an endorsement interview. Amongst his concepts for the workplace is a return to in-person, paper-ballot voting. In a area the place know-how abounds, King County residents anticipate elected officers to be forward-thinking, not caught in a long time passed by. Voters ought to once more put their confidence in Julie Smart for King County elections director.
